Copper & PEX repiping is the process of replacing old, corroded, or leaking plumbing pipes in a property with new, durable copper or PEX (cross-linked polyethylene) piping. Property owners typically need this service when they experience frequent leaks, low water pressure, discolored water, or have outdated galvanized steel or polybutylene pipes that are prone to failure.
Neglecting repiping can lead to extensive water damage, mold growth, and unsanitary water conditions, significantly devaluing your property. Proactive repiping ensures reliable water flow, improves water quality, and prevents costly emergency repairs in your Dayton home.

How long does a typical repiping project take in Dayton?
Most residential repiping projects in Dayton can be completed within 3 to 5 days, depending on the size of the home and the complexity of the plumbing system.
Will I have to move out of my house during the repiping process?
In most cases, you will not need to move out. Our team works efficiently to minimize disruption, often restoring water service each evening, though some temporary water shut-offs are necessary during the day.
What are the main advantages of PEX over copper piping?
PEX is generally more affordable, flexible (reducing the need for fittings), and resistant to freezing. Copper, while more expensive, is highly durable, resistant to UV light, and has a longer proven lifespan.
Does repiping include drain lines or just water supply lines?
This service specifically addresses water supply lines (freshwater). Repiping of drain, waste, and vent (DWV) lines is a separate service, though we can certainly assess your DWV system during the repiping consultation.
